“Great New Year Stay”
5 of 5 stars Reviewed 4 January 2012

I stayed 3 nights over the New Year holiday.
The welcome was first class and the hospitality shown by Russell & Marie is perfect. They run a very friendly and efficient establishment which I cannot recommend highly enough.
We had a room at the front (with a great view) which is a little tight when moving around the bed due to the sloping ceiling, but it was spotlessly clean, the furniture was new and the bed very comfortable. For once my wife was able to sit at the dressing table and use the hair drier. (Something which is for ever over looked in many establishments). The shower room appeared recently re tiled and was well laid out.
There is a guest lounge situated on the first floor which had a beautifully shaped and decorated Christmas Tree in it. This is a very homely and Russell & Marie operate a very reasonably priced drinks service.
The breakfast and the accompanying service was excellent. There was a good choice of cereals and fruit followed by a perfectly presented and cooked breakfast. We are Vegetarians and on each of the 3 mornings Russell cooked a different version of a potato rosti style potato dish to accompany the perfectly poached eggs, tomatoes and mushrooms.
This is a first class establishment and will be my first choice for any stay in the Lakes.

“Our third excellent stay!”
5 of 5 stars Reviewed 3 January 2012

This was our third trip to Keswick over New Year 2011 and our third stay in the Edwardene with Marie and Russ. We keep going back because we are made to feel welcome every time we stay.
This is a large, lakeland slate building (originally two houses) and looks fantastic from the outside. Inside the property is beautifully decorated with serene, calming colours, and after walking the hills all day, is always warm and cosy!
Ok, the bedrooms aren't huge, but are more than big enough for us and all our clothes, and are always clean and extremely comfortable. There's more than enough to do in and around Keswick anyway, so you won't be sitting in your room for long.
We normally stay in Linnet (a small shower ensuite), and this time, tried Tansy with a bath (luxury after a muddy walk!). The ensuites are always clean and tidy, and the towels are nice and fluffy.
Breakfasts are fantastic and the full Cumbrian breakfast is excellent - highly recommended. In fact, I would say the breakfasts are a highlight of our stays!
Russ and Marie are great, and look after you really well, even taking our muddy walking gear off us each afternoon to dry in their drying room!
The B&B is a short (5 mins) walk from the Moot Hall in the Square, but this probably suits better as it's a slightly quieter location as you don't see or hear everyone leaving the pubs at closing time.
I know we'll be back to visit again, and have already recommended The Edwardene to friends and family!

“A New Year retreat”
5 of 5 stars Reviewed 2 January 2012

We stayed for 3 nights at the Edwardene Hotel to celebrate New Year, we arrived after a long journey to a very warm welcome from the owner. The room (Heather) was immaculate and very cosy - a small double room with en-suite bathroom with shower over the bath. Everything that we needed was provided in the room (toiletries and even a hair drier).

The breakfast was very filling and delicious, nothing was too much trouble. Even when I asked for items that were not on the menu.

The location was ideal, we were able to walk into the centre of town within five minutes which meant that we could leave our car parked up for the duration of our stay. Although the hotel is located near town, we found the room to be quiet at night.

The owner recommended a number of places to eat and marked them on a map for us. We left our bottle of Champagne in our room and to our delight found that she had chilled it for us before we went out on New Years Eve! (Nothing was ever too much trouble for her).

There are several walks from Keswick town centre which are ideal for all walking abilities - a good website to visit that offers downloadable printable maps in PDF format is http://www.keswick.org/what-to-do/walking-routes

One of the walks that we can recommend is the Keswick to Threlkeld railway path - this walk took us two hours taking in lovely scenery and local history along the way, we finished our walk by visiting the "Horse and Farrier Inn" at Threlkeld that offered excellent meals in a friendly traditional pub atmosphere.

“Immaculate hotel in convenient location”
5 of 5 stars Reviewed 4 November 2011

We stayed at the Edwardene for 2 nights in October and were extremely pleased with the location, quality and service. Due to booking late we were allocated the last available room, 'Myrtle', which was a small double room with a good en-suite shower (quality toiletries provided - even cotton buds!) The rooms had clearly been refurbished recently, to a very high standard, and the cleanliness throughout the hotel was absolutely first class. The hotel stands out as a quality establishment as soon as you view its exterior.Breakfast was lovely and the owners were very welcoming and helpful. The only potential issues for us was that there is limited parking in the road close to the hotel (although the owner happily moved his vehicle to enable us to park opposite, so that we could unload our luggage) so at times it may be dificult to find a space nearby. We were also unable to connect to the Wi-fi (although this could have been a problem with our laptop rather than the hotel!) After arriving home we were telephoned by the owner, as we had left an item of clothing behind in our room, and they kindly parcelled it up and posted it to us. Overall, a relaxed, friendly and highly recommended hotel.

Room Tip: Ask for a room on the front of the hotel
